My Brother's first BonJovi Concert - It was announced that Bon Jovi would be coming to the Air Canada Centre in Toronto on Feb. 20th 2003. From the second that concert was announced my 14 year old brother wanted to go. He has watched and listened to the band ever since I made him listen to Crossroad, then Crush, and Bounce. His birthday is Feb 19th and what better way to celebrate his birthday than with Bon Jovi. He couldn't afford the ticket so for months he tried to think of ways to get a ticket to this show. Little did he know I had already bought him a ticket to the show. For weeks leading up to his birthday he asked me to help him get a ticket, I told him I couldn't afford it for him and he seemed to understand, I could tell he was upset. On the day of his birthday I picked up a box from a Playstation 2 game that I knew he did not want, put the ticket in and resealed the case to make it look good. He looked disappointed when he opened his gift and my friend asked him to go play the game, he said yes just to be nice. He went to his PS2, opened the game and was in absolute shock. I have never seen my brother so surprised in his life. The following night we went to the show at the Air Canada Centre with a good friend and he had the time of his life, he wanted to hear his favourites (The Distance and Joey) and they played both. It was a great time and I hope it was a birthday that my brother Scott will never forget.
